Re: Strange error when trying to intercept sysNotifyVolumeMountedEvent
by Dr. Vesselin Bontchev

REPLY TO AUTHOR
 
REPLY TO GROUP




> When I receive control with the custom launch code from
> SysAppLaunch, do I have to eat events until the first
> appStopEvent and only *then* enter my normal event loop??

OK, the exit event apparently comes from the Launcher? I tried eating it. This works *if* it is the Launcher running when the volume mounting notification arrives. If it is some other application, I never get the exit event and the whole thing hangs.

If I *don't* eat the exit event, everything works *if* some application other than the Launcher is running when the notification arrives. It doesn't have to be my application - it could be the Calculator or anything else. But if it is the Launcher that is running, I crash.

I don't understand why this is happening. :-( But one way to solve it would be to determine whether it is the Launcher that is running when the notification arrives.

How do I do that? And what about third-party launchers?
